18 killed, including policemen and mayor, in Mexico’s City Hall shooting


 

Mexico Firing: An open shooting incident has come to light in Mexico, USA. Gunmen opened fire at the Mexican City Hall, killing 18 people, including the mayor. Three people were also injured.

According to reports, an event was going on in the Mexican City Hall, during which an unidentified person entered the hall and opened indiscriminate fire.

18 people died in this firing incident. It is being told that apart from the mayor, his father, former mayor and police officers were also killed in the dead. At the same time, since the incident, an atmosphere of tension has been created in the entire area.

Gunmen opened fire at the city hall in Guerrero state on Wednesday (October 5) afternoon, killing more than a dozen people, including the city’s mayor, BNO News reported, citing local officials. The shooting took place in the city of San Miguel Totolapan. Officials have confirmed this. Gunmen attacked City Hall at 2 p.m. local time on Wednesday.

Some pictures of the incident have also surfaced. In the pictures being shared on social media, bullet marks can be seen on the walls of City Hall. The glass of the hall windows is also broken.

After which the entire city is existing blocked and the accused are being searched, although not a single arrest has been made so far.
